Bumper Softening Oven

Updated: 2026-07-15

Overview

Bumper softening ovens are essential industrial equipment for processing protective edge strips made of EPDM rubber, PVC, or thermoplastic elastomers. These ovens apply controlled heat to reduce material hardness, making bumpers more pliable for installation or reshaping during manufacturing processes. Common in automotive parts factories and furniture production lines, these systems bridge material science with practical manufacturing needs. The technology has evolved from basic convection ovens to sophisticated systems with multi-zone temperature control to handle varied bumper profiles and material thicknesses.

Structure and Working Principle

A standard bumper softening oven consists of an insulated chamber, heating elements, air circulation system, and control panel. The chamber is typically constructed from 304-grade stainless steel with ceramic fiber insulation to maintain thermal efficiency. Heating occurs through electric resistance coils or infrared emitters, while centrifugal fans ensure even heat distribution. The working principle involves conductive and convective heat transfer. Bumpers are loaded onto racks or conveyor systems, then exposed to temperatures between 60-180°C for 5-30 minutes depending on material specifications. Advanced models incorporate humidity control to prevent material degradation during the softening process.

Key Features

Modern bumper softening ovens offer several critical features for industrial applications. Precision temperature control systems maintain ±2°C accuracy through PID controllers and multiple thermocouples. Safety features include over-temperature protection, door interlocks, and emergency stop buttons compliant with OSHA standards. Energy efficiency is achieved through heat recovery systems and insulated double-wall construction. Many industrial-grade ovens now feature touchscreen interfaces with recipe storage, allowing operators to save parameters for different bumper materials and profiles. Some high-end models integrate IoT capabilities for remote monitoring and predictive maintenance.

Application Areas

The primary application is automotive manufacturing, where these ovens prepare door edge guards, bumper trims, and wheel arch protectors for installation. In furniture production, they treat corner protectors for office desks, cabinets, and children's furniture before adhesive application. Additional uses include processing industrial edge protectors for glass panels, metal sheets, and construction materials. The medical equipment industry utilizes smaller versions for softening protective edges on wheelchairs and hospital beds. Customized ovens serve niche applications like marine fender conditioning or aircraft interior trim processing.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ance includes monthly inspection of heating elements, quarterly calibration of temperature sensors, and annual replacement of door gaskets. Always power off the unit before cleaning interior surfaces with non-abrasive cleaners to prevent damage to reflective surfaces. Critical precautions involve proper loading capacity (never exceed 80% of chamber volume) and using compatible materials (avoid PVC above 140°C without ventilation). Install carbon monoxide detectors when processing certain rubber compounds. Always follow the manufacturer's guidelines for ramp-up/cool-down rates to prevent thermal shock to materials.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ing bumper softening ovens, first determine your production requirements: batch size (typically 50-500 bumpers per cycle), maximum part dimensions, and target throughput. Evaluate heating technology - infrared works faster for thin materials while convection provides better results for thick profiles. Request documentation for energy consumption (kW/hr) and compliance certificates (CE, UL, ISO 9001). For international buyers, verify voltage compatibility (common options: 220V/380V/440V). Consider after-sales support availability for critical components like controllers and heating elements. Leading manufacturers often provide FAT (Factory Acceptance Testing) and installation supervision services.
